Primary Responsibilities
- Complies with all Company and Regulatory HS&E, Quality and IT standards and policies. Wears all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) as required and maintains required HS&E and SQ certifications up to date.
- Complies with the requirements of various specifications such as Phosphating Procedure and the DRILCO Machine Shop Services Procedures Manual, and is knowledgeable and competent in their use and application.
- Operates forklift to load and unload trucks and racks with tubular products in a safe and efficient manner.
- Ensures all loading and unloading areas are free of personnel prior to loading or unloading tubular products.
- Manages consumable inventory levels to ensure all supplies needed are in stock.
- Operates and maintains thread protector cleaner, phosphate units, pipe cleaner, and conveyor systems.
- Maintains safe and organized storage areas for drill pipe and downhole tools in storage yard and service areas.
- Performs risk analysis (e.g., HARC, JSA) before each job or task and identifies and addresses potential safety hazards. Corrects and reports hazards immediately to the direct supervisor.
- Conducts material split in TMS MRT to update location and status each time tubular products are moved.
- Completes all required pre- and post-job documentation and job tickets on time and without errors as per company policy.
- Ensures that all completed job documentation is returned to the operating district upon completion for expedited customer billing/invoicing.
- Safely and efficiently utilizes all tools and equipment to support the timely completion of assigned work orders and/or duties, and to optimize throughput.
- Leads and supports continuous improvement projects.
- Develops technical knowledge through on‑the‑job training and certification classes.
- Works with Manager to prepare for future career opportunities.
- Coaches and mentors less experienced rack hand trainees.
- Handles special projects as assigned.
- All other duties as assigned by Supervisor.
- High School Diploma or GED equivalent.
- Certified forklift operator.
- Experience with Drill Pipe and Downhole Tools preferred.
- Minimum of one year experience in related field.
- Must be willing to work long hours and be on call 24 hours/day.
- Knowledge of hand power tools, (i.e., grinders).
- Must be able to stand for long periods of time.
- Excellent work ethic, demonstrated by a positive attitude and completing your work on time.
- Basic computer skills: MS Word, Outlook, Excel and PowerPoint.
- Ability to work in adverse weather conditions.
- Strong communication skills, including verbal, written and nonverbal communication.
- Strong organizational, problem-solving, and analytical skills.
- Ability to manage priorities and workflow.
